What is a Bedside Cot?
A bedside cot, also called a co-sleeper or side sleeper, is a kind of crib that is designed to attach safely to the side of the parent's bed. It permits easy access to the baby throughout the night while supplying a separate sleeping space. This design supports safe sleep practices while facilitating nighttime feeding and soothing.

Promotes Safe Sleep
Bedside cots follow safe sleep guidelines as the infant has its own sleeping space. This separation decreases the danger of suffocation and overheating, which are typical interest in standard co-sleeping arrangements.
2. Enhances Bonding
Having a Bedside Cot For Sleeping Arrangements cot enables parents to respond rapidly to their baby's requirements throughout the night. This proximity can enhance the parent-child bond and encourage a psychological connection.
3. Assists In Nighttime Feeding
For breastfeeding moms, bedside cots provide the ideal service for nighttime feedings without the requirement to completely wake up or rise.
4. Reduces Stress
The close range enables parents to feel more at ease, understanding they can look at their baby without rising. This arrangement can cause a more relaxing sleep for both the parent and the child.
5. Versatile Use
Lots of Bedside Cot For Easy Night Feeding cots can transform into standalone cribs, making them a long-term financial investment in your child's sleeping arrangements. They can often be utilized until the kid is around 6-12 months old, depending upon the particular model.
Factors to consider When Choosing a Bedside Cot
When acquiring a bedside cot, it is vital to consider different elements:
1. Security Standards
Make sure that the cot adheres to regional safety regulations. Look for brands that have been checked and certified for security.
2. Bed mattress Quality
The quality of the bed mattress is crucial for the health and comfort of the baby. A company, supportive mattress is needed to prevent issues such as SIDS (Sudden Infant Death Syndrome).
3. Budget plan
Bedside cots are available in a series of rates. Set a budget plan and consider the best worth for the features you require.
4. Size and Space
Make certain to examine the measurements of the cot and make sure that it fits well next to your bed. If space is a concern, select a model that is quickly portable or foldable.
5. Alleviate of Assembly
Some cots are more complicated to assemble than others. Search for designs that are easy to use, especially if you anticipate moving the cot more than once.

Are bedside cots safe for newborns?
Yes, bedside cots are created to offer a safe sleeping environment for newborns, supplied they fulfill safety requirements and are established correctly.
2. At what age can my baby transition from a bedside cot?
Typically, babies can use bedside cots till they have to do with 6-12 months old or up until they can pull themselves up or roll over. Always refer to the producer's standards.
3. Can bedside cots be used for taking a trip?
Numerous bedside cots are portable and foldable, making them ideal for travel. However, guarantee that the particular model you select is developed for easy transportation.
4. How do I ensure the bedside cot is safe and secure to my bed?
Follow the manufacturer's instructions carefully for connecting the cot to your bed. The majority of models have mechanisms to secure them securely.
5. Can I use a routine crib instead of a bedside cot?
While a regular crib provides a safe sleeping space, it does not offer the same convenience for nighttime access and bonding that bedside cots do.
